二叉树搜索算法

@别殃757:二叉树算法 - 搜狗百科
殳晶19616299194…… 是错误的 二叉树是一种很有用的非线性结构,具有以下两个特点: ①非空二叉树只有一个根结点; ②每一个结点最多有两棵子树,且分别称为该结点的左子树和右子树. 由以上特点可以看出,在二叉树中,每一个结点的度最大为2,即所有子...

@别殃757:C语言 二叉树 递归查找算法 -
殳晶19616299194…… 你的if(T->data==x)后面的{}里面没有返回,导致不能及时推出 望采纳,谢谢

@别殃757:二叉树查找的c语言描述
殳晶19616299194…… 二叉树实现源代码如下: #include <conio.h> #include <stdio.h> #include <stdlib.h> #define OK 1 #define ERROR 0 #define TRUE 1 #define FALSE 0 #define OVERFLOW -2 typedef int status; typedef strUCt BiNode { char Data; struct BiNode* ...

@别殃757:平衡二叉树的具体算法 -
殳晶19616299194…… 平衡二叉搜索树双称为AVL树,它也是一棵二叉搜索树,是对二叉搜索树的一种改进,或都是具有下列性质的二叉树:它的左子树和右子树都是平衡二叉树,且左子树和右子树的深度之差的绝对值不超过1. 平衡因子(Balance Factor,BF)定...

@别殃757:查找二叉树节点度为1或2的个数的算法 -
殳晶19616299194…… 递归算法:find(treenode *t) { if(t->left==NULL&&t->right==NULL) return ; else { cout<<t->data; if(t->left!=NULL) find(&t->left); if(t->right!=NULL) find(&t->right); } } 这是哥第一次给人回答问题.哈哈

@别殃757:二叉树排序算法实现 急!急!急! -
殳晶19616299194…… 每次新来一个数,都根据其大小插入二叉树中1. root = null2. 首先,p = root, 将新来的数字A与节点p中的数字进行比较, 2.1 如果,节点p == null, p = new Node(); 且,该节点中的数字等于A 2.2 如果A比节点p中的数字大,p = p->rightChild 2.3 如果A比节点p中的数字小,p = p->leftChild

@别殃757:二叉树查找和二分查找是同一算法吗 -
殳晶19616299194…… 两者的算法思路其实很像:比中间的小就在剩下的左边,大就在剩下的右边找 但是:二叉树查找一般习惯是在链式存储上进行,为一个树形结构 二分查找一定在顺序存储上进行

@别殃757:从一棵二叉树中查找出所有结点的最大值. -
殳晶19616299194…… #include <stdio.h>//头文件 #include <stdlib.h> #include <malloc.h> typedef struct BiTNode { int data; struct BiTNode *lchild,*rchild; } BiTNode,*BiTree;//定义结点类型 int max=-100;//把max定义得足够小 BiTree CreateBiTree()//先序递归创建树 ...

相关推荐

  • 二叉树遍历画图
  • 二叉树的遍历算法
  • 二叉树的正确算法
  • 二叉树的度和结点图解
  • 二叉树计算题大全
  • 二叉树的计算方法图解
  • 二叉树结构图解大全
  • 二叉树计算的全部公式
  • 最简单的二叉树图解
  • 二叉树及其三种遍历
  • 二叉树的三种遍历代码
  • 二叉树前序中序后序
  • 二叉树的度怎么算
  • 二叉树公式大全
  • 二叉树结点与度的计算公式
  • 二叉树三种遍历详解
  • 二叉树的遍历图解例题
  • 二叉树的画法顺序图
  • 二叉树的算法设计
  • 二叉树计算公式
  • 二叉树的结点数图解
  • 二叉树公式
  • 二叉树深度计算公式
  • 二叉树图解
  • 二叉树后序遍历图解
  • 二叉树遍历的三种方法
  • 本文由网友投稿,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
    若有什么问题请联系我们
    2024© 客安网